检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
RT和DELETE权限。 目标库使用gsloader等工具创建相关系统表(如 public.pgxc_copy_error_log,public.gs_copy_summary)时,DRS访问相关系统表需要有系统表的all privilege权限,详细信息可参考《GaussDB工具参考》。
源数据库的IP地址或域名、数据库用户名和密码,会被系统加密暂存,直至删除该迁移任务后自动清除。 图6 目标库信息 表10 目标库信息 参数 描述 数据库实例名称 默认为创建同步任务时选择的DDM实例,不可进行修改。 数据库用户名 目标数据库对应的数据库用户名。 数据库密码 数据库用户名和密码将被系统加密暂存,直至该任务删除后清除。
不支持同步列存表、压缩表、延迟表、临时表、含生成列的表,增量不建议同步非日志表。 不支持同步既是无主键表,又是分区表的自建表,可能会导致数据不一致或者任务失败。 不支持同步系统schema(pg_toast、cstore、snapshot、sys、dbms_job、dbms_perf、pg_catalog、inf
灾备同步时延也可在“实时灾备管理”界面查看,当时延超过用户设置或系统默认的时延阈值时,任务管理界面增量时延显示为红色。 当时延为0s时,表示业务数据库和灾备数据库进入近实时同步状态,此时可以通过“灾备监控”页签查看更多时延指标,如RPO、RTO等。 时延 = 源库当前系统时间 - 成功同步到目标库的最新一个事务在源库的提交成功时间。
RT和DELETE权限。 目标库使用gsloader等工具创建相关系统表(如 public.pgxc_copy_error_log,public.gs_copy_summary)时,DRS访问相关系统表需要有系统表的all privilege权限,详细信息可参考《GaussDB工具参考》。
文件导入时,支持表的同步。 不支持系统模式(“pg_”开头的任何模式、“information_schema”、“sys”、“utl_raw”、“dbms_lob”、“dbms_output”和“dbms_random”)、系统表、系统用户、表空间、外部数据包装器、外部服务器、用户映射、发布、订阅等其他对象。
支持数据库、表、用户、视图、索引、约束、函数、存储过程、触发器(trigger)和事件(event)的迁移。 仅支持MyISAM和InnoDB表的迁移。 不支持系统库的迁移以及事件状态的迁移。 - 无主键表检查 由于无主键表的性能低于主键表的性能,建议将无主键表修改为主键表。 详见源库无主键表检查。 关联对象检查
文本搜索模板的同步。 表级同步时,仅支持表、视图、物化视图、序列、普通索引的同步。 文件导入时,支持表的同步。 不支持系统模式、系统表、系统用户、系统函数等系统对象;不支持表空间、外部数据包装器、外部服务器、用户映射、发布、订阅、用户等其他对象;不支持对象权限的同步。 说明: 支持同步的对象有如下限制:
提交批量创建异步任务 功能介绍 提交批量创建异步任务,当批量异步任务创建或更新参数后,系统会自动开始进行参数校验,待所有任务成功完成参数校验后并且无报错时,可调用此接口开始创建DRS任务实例。 调试 您可以在API Explorer中调试该接口,支持自动认证鉴权。API Expl
创建数据级表对比任务 功能介绍 创建数据级表对比任务。 URI POST /v3/{project_id}/jobs/{job_id}/table/compare 表1 路径参数 参数 是否必选 参数类型 描述 project_id 是 String 租户在某一Region下的Project
目标数据库的block_size参数值必须大于源库中的对应参数值。 目标数据库不可以包含,与待同步对象类型相同且名称相同的对象,包括库、模式、表等。系统库、系统模式、系统表等除外。 同步的表要禁用外键,因为DRS并行回放会使得不同表之间的写入顺序和源库不一致,可能会触发外键约束限制,造成同步失败。
table> TO <user>; 目标库使用gsloader等工具创建相关系统表(如 public.pgxc_copy_error_log,public.gs_copy_summary)时,DRS访问相关系统表需要有系统表的all privilege权限,详细信息可参考《GaussDB工具参考》。
集群:目前只支持集合(包括验证器,是否是固定集合),分片键,索引和视图的迁移。 单节点:目前只支持集合(包括验证器,是否是固定集合),索引和视图的迁移。 不支持迁移系统库(如local、admin、config等)的迁移,用户名和角色需要在目标库手动创建。 不支持视图的创建语句中有正则表达式。 不支持_id字段没有索引的集合。
MySQL、GaussDB(for MySQL)为源链路,源数据库中的虚拟列不支持内容对比,对比时会过滤虚拟列。 对数据库影响 对象对比:会查询源库及目标库的系统表,占用10个左右的session的连接数,正常情况不会对数据库产生影响。但是如果对象数量巨大(比如几十万张表),可能会对数据库产生一定的查询压力。
最大支持上传500KB的证书文件。 如果不启用SSL安全连接,请自行承担数据安全风险。 源数据库的IP地址或域名、数据库用户名和密码,会被系统加密暂存,直至删除该同步任务后自动清除。 目标库信息配置 图7 目标库信息 表10 目标库信息 参数 描述 数据库实例名称 默认为创建同步任务时选择的RDS
tableData:同步数据 tableStructure:同步表结构 constraintData:索引同步 说明: 除supportAllType以外,其他类型可组合填写,例如:"tableData,tableStructure" 。 increment_read_mode String
在任务创建、启动、全量同步、增量同步、结束等过程中,如有遇到问题,可先参考“故障排查”章节进行排查。 其他限制 对于目标库MariaDB的系统参数enforce_storage_engine,如果该参数值为InnoDB,那么DRS不支持同步存储引擎为MyISAM的表结构和数据到目
tableData:同步数据 tableStructure:同步表结构 constraintData:索引同步 说明: 除supportAllType以外,其他类型可组合填写,例如:"tableData,tableStructure" 。 increment_read_mode 否
point,polygon等地理坐标类型 不支持视图、约束、函数、存储过程、触发器(TRIGGER)和事件(EVENT)的同步。 不支持系统库的同步以及事件状态的同步。 目标库Oracle不支持空字符串,同步对象含有非空约束的字段中不能包含空字符串。 源数据库MySQL支持的最
table> TO <user>; 目标库使用gsloader等工具创建相关系统表(如 public.pgxc_copy_error_log,public.gs_copy_summary)时,DRS访问相关系统表需要有系统表的all privilege权限,详细信息可参考《GaussDB工具参考》。